你查询的IP:[119.80.59.212]  地理位置:中国–北京–北京

最新查询134.196.55.21 203.86.36.236 124.128.62.75 202.96.203.65 121.56.156.33 58.82.237.154 119.162.115.227 125.64.33.252 221.8.3.21 119.80.59.212 220.248.61.188 202.112.163.142 119.18.208.66 121.16.214.202 117.120.128.27 123.4.6.25 202.165.176.68 119.18.208.63 221.200.26.234 119.18.224.251 221.12.128.71 202.123.96.38 119.57.228.123 221.199.174.222 203.208.32.133 118.230.89.117 122.49.58.176 124.126.136.171 203.110.160.228 202.90.224.65 203.191.144.125